ENGLISH LANGUAGE ARTS

Students will learn creative and critical literacy practices and how to effectively communicate to diverse audiences through the study of non-fiction, short stories, novels, poetry, art, and media. The curriculum is achieved through transdisciplinary forms of inquiry-based and student-led research. The three competencies outlines by the Ministry are: 1) Talking, 2) Reading/Listening, and 3) Production.

MEDIA

This course emphasizes knowledge and skills that will enable students to understand media communications in the twenty-first century and to use media creatively, critically, effectively and responsibly. Through analysing the forms and messages of a variety of media works, and through creating their own media works, students will develop critical thinking skills, aesthetic and ethical judgment, and skills in viewing, representing, listening, speaking, and creating. Video and audio production, website and entrepreneurial development, and design skills are points of focus.

VISUAL ART

This course works on developing students’ confidence in studio art and building general knowledge, both cultural/historical, in art history and artistic practice. It also delves into creative and critical thinking, along with personal and social responsibility. In line with the curriculum, this course fosters creative process and artistic inquiry through thematic and student-centered explorations of 2D, 3D and Integrated Media Practices. The two competencies outlined by the Ministry are: 1) Analyzing and appreciating artworks and 2) Creating artworks.
